Nicki Minaj Explains Why It's Bad For Rappers To Jump On Trends [VIDEO]

By Daryl Nelson
pixel_start

Even though Nicki Minaj and Joe Budden have gotten into it in the past, they've set aside their differences and sat down for some interesting interviews.

Their latest chat will soon be released and a clip of it was just posted. In it, Nicki speaks about rappers jumping on sound trends and how it's bad for their career.


"You know, once anybody has success with anything, it seems like everybody just jumps on that sound,” said Nicki. “Even if they may not have even liked it, it might be people behind them telling them to do it ... Once you do that and once you do it a couple times, who then are you? We’ve now forgotten who you are. I don’t think that people realize that. If you jump on every trend, you become faceless.”
